CommVault Systems Receives Strong Ratings from Analysts

CommVault Systems (NASDAQ: CVLT) has attracted attention from analysts following a series of ratings updates. On October 31, 2023, Stephens initiated coverage on the software company, issuing an **overweight** rating and setting a target price of **$162.00**. This marks a significant endorsement for CommVault, which specializes in data protection and information management software.

Several analysts have recently updated their positions on CommVault. On October 27, 2023, **Robert W. Baird** upgraded the stock to a **strong-buy** rating, with a price target of **$215.00**. The same day, KeyCorp adjusted its target price from **$225.00** to **$185.00**, maintaining an **overweight** rating. Additionally, **Oppenheimer** began coverage on November 10, 2023, issuing an **outperform** rating. As a result of these updates, CommVault has garnered a consensus rating of **Moderate Buy** from analysts, with an average price target of **$191.92**.

CommVault Systems reported its quarterly earnings on **October 28, 2023**, revealing an earnings per share (EPS) of **$0.91**, which fell short of the consensus estimate of **$0.95** by **$0.04**. The company reported revenue of **$276.19 million**, exceeding analyst expectations of **$273.31 million**. This represents an **18.4%** increase in revenue compared to the same quarter last year, where the EPS was **$0.83**.

Insider Transactions and Institutional Investment

In addition to analyst ratings, insider trading activity has also been notable. **Sanjay Mirchandani**, the CEO of CommVault, sold **14,653** shares on November 18, 2023, at an average price of **$123.65**, totaling approximately **$1.81 million**. After this transaction, Mirchandani retained **372,369** shares, valued at around **$46 million**. This sale reflects a **3.79%** decrease in his ownership stake.

Another insider, **Gary Merrill**, sold **2,674** shares the same day at an average price of **$123.58**, totaling around **$330,452**. Following this transaction, Merrill owns **69,163** shares valued at approximately **$8.55 million**, also representing a **3.72%** decrease in ownership. Over the past three months, insiders have sold a total of **33,111** shares valued at **$4.06 million**. Currently, insiders hold **1.00%** of CommVault’s stock.

Institutional investment in CommVault has seen fluctuating activity. During the second quarter of 2023, the State of Wyoming acquired a new stake in the company worth approximately **$35,000**. Other significant investments include **Banque Cantonale Vaudoise**, which invested **$39,000** in the third quarter, and **Cullen Frost Bankers Inc.**, which increased its stake by **43.8%** during the same period. Currently, institutional investors and hedge funds own **93.50%** of the company’s stock.

Overview of CommVault Systems

CommVault Systems, based in **Tinton Falls, New Jersey**, is a global leader in data protection and information management solutions. Founded in **1996**, the company offers a range of products designed to help organizations manage, protect, and activate data across various environments, including on-premises and cloud solutions.

Key offerings include **Commvault Complete Data Protection**, **Commvault HyperScale**, and the SaaS-based **Metallic portfolio**. These solutions provide scalable and automated data management capabilities that help enterprises streamline operations and enhance data resiliency.
